Matlab仿真:模拟人体心血管系统动态

版权申诉
0 下载量 182 浏览量 更新于2024-10-05 收藏 3.34MB ZIP 举报
资源摘要信息:"基于Matlab模拟人体心血管系统的流量和压力" 1. Matlab软件应用领域概述: Matlab(Matrix Laboratory的缩写)是美国MathWorks公司出品的一套高性能数值计算和可视化软件。它集数学计算、算法开发、数据分析和可视化、以及绘图和图形设计于一体,广泛应用于工程计算、控制系统、信息处理和信号处理、金融分析等多个领域。Matlab2014和Matlab2019a指的是两个不同的版本,它们提供了不同的功能和改进,用户可以根据个人或项目需求选择合适的版本。 2. 智能优化算法与神经网络预测: 智能优化算法通常用于解决优化问题,包括遗传算法、粒子群优化、模拟退火等。神经网络预测则指利用人工神经网络模型对数据进行学习和预测,广泛应用于模式识别、时间序列预测、图像处理等。Matlab提供了一系列工具箱来支持这些算法的实现和仿真。 3. 信号处理与元胞自动机: 信号处理涉及到信号的采集、存储、分析、处理和展示等环节。Matlab提供了丰富的信号处理工具箱,支持各种信号处理任务。元胞自动机(Cellular Automata,CA)是一种离散模型,广泛应用于复杂系统建模和动态模拟,Matlab可用于CA的仿真和分析。 4. 图像处理与路径规划: Matlab的图像处理工具箱能够提供图像增强、去噪、配准、分割和特征提取等功能。路径规划则指在给定环境中寻找从起始点到目标点的最优或可行路径,Matlab能够用于机器人路径规划和无人机航迹规划等。 5. Matlab在医学领域的应用: 模拟人体心血管系统的流量和压力是医学工程领域的一项重要研究。通过Matlab建立的人体心血管系统的数学模型,可以模拟心脏跳动产生的血液流动和血管内的压力变化。这种模拟可以帮助医学研究人员更好地理解和分析心血管疾病,为临床诊断和治疗提供理论支持。 6. Matlab仿真工具的教育意义: Matlab仿真工具对于本科和硕士等教育阶段的教学与研究具有重要作用。它能够帮助学生和研究者在没有物理实验条件的情况下,通过模拟实验来学习和掌握复杂的理论知识。同时,Matlab也适合用于开发、测试和验证新的算法和模型。 7. Matlab项目合作与技术支持: 对于Matlab项目开发和应用,除了可以利用现有的工具箱和函数库之外,还可以通过博主头像点击进入博主的主页进行交流,寻求技术支持或进行项目合作。这种合作可以是个人间的协助,也可以是企业与技术人员之间的合作开发。 8. 学习与使用资源: 对于有兴趣学习和使用Matlab进行心血管系统模拟的科研人员或学生来说,可以从博主的主页搜索相关的博客和教程。这些资源可能包括项目的详细说明、运行指导、仿真结果分析等,可以帮助用户快速上手并深入理解。 通过上述知识点的介绍,可以看出Matlab不仅是一个强大的工程计算软件,还是科研、教学和工程应用中不可或缺的工具,尤其在心血管系统模拟等医学工程领域中展现出其独特的优势和潜力。